Citrate/F− assisted phase control synthesis of TiO2 nanostructures and their photocatalytic properties†
Abstract
A novel and controlled sol-hydrothermal synthesis of nano-TiO2 assisted by citrate/F− has been developed. We studied factors that influence its size and morphology, such as citrate, Cl−, F− and so on. Different ratios of citrate to TiCl4 gave different sizes and morphologies. Cl− preferentially formed a rutile phase, while citrate preferentially formed an anatase phase, and F− gave a dominant {001} facet. Additionally, we found that the photocatalytic activity of the TiO2 synthesised with the assistance of citrate was superior to the commercially available TiO2.
